Dial-A-Ride services expanding

Starting Aug. 3, a new service will offer seniors van rides between the cities of Thousand Oaks, Moorpark, Simi Valley, unincorporated areas and other places in the East County. The intercity Dial-A-Ride and Americans with Disabilities Act program will allow seniors 65 and older and ADA cardholders to travel between most areas in eastern Ventura [...]
